Hyper CHIPLED
Hyper-Bright LED
LS Q976, LO Q976, LY Q976

Features
• package: 0603
• feature of the device: smallest package
1.6 mm x 0.8 mm x 0.8 mm
• wavelength: 632 nm (super-red),
605 nm (orange), 587 nm (yellow)
• viewing angle: extremely wide (160°)
• technology: InGaAlP
• optical efficiency: 7 lm/W (super-red),
11 lm/W (orange, yellow)
• assembly methods: suitable for all
SMT assembly methods
• soldering methods: IR reflow soldering
• preconditioning: acc. to JEDEC Level 2
• taping: 8 mm tape with 4000/reel, ø180

Applications
• outdoor displays
• flat backlighting (LCD, cellular phones,
switches, displays)
• signal and symbol luminaire
• marker lights (e.g. steps, exit ways, etc.)
